Output 2eb2012398c255abb6ddc35a6233836d42aa73c1e126bd056ebf128aea96de2a:20

value
2504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3941f40aee9dab5effef94ab939fa160c0fffe1 OP_EQUAL
address
3KX98eqtcpp7AxhcsDcq6fY8hdPEYyKBPG
transaction
2eb2012398c255abb6ddc35a6233836d42aa73c1e126bd056ebf128aea96de2a
spent
true